Key Responsibilities – What You’ll Do Every Day
As a Remote Data Entry Specialist at arenaflex, you will be entrusted with the meticulous handling of sensitive information. Your day‑to‑day duties will include:
- Accurately entering large volumes of healthcare‑related data into arenaflex’s secure platforms.
- Verifying the completeness and correctness of each entry, flagging inconsistencies for review.
- Collaborating with cross‑functional teams—such as data analysts, quality assurance, and project managers—to maintain uniform data standards.
- Upholding strict confidentiality protocols and adhering to data security policies in line with industry regulations.
- Meeting daily and weekly data entry targets while ensuring high‑quality output.
- Performing routine audits of entered data to identify and correct errors before they propagate.
- Supporting additional administrative tasks, such as preparing simple reports, updating documentation, and assisting with onboarding of new remote team members.
Essential Qualifications – What We Require
To succeed in this role, you should meet the following baseline criteria:
- High school diploma or equivalent; additional coursework or certification in data entry, office administration, or a related field is a plus.
- Proven experience (minimum 6 months) in a data entry or similar administrative role, preferably in a remote setting.
- Typing speed of at least 55 words per minute with a high degree of accuracy (≥ 98%).
- Exceptional attention to detail and the ability to spot discrepancies quickly.
- Pro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ite (Excel, Word, Outlook) and familiarity with cloud‑based data entry tools.
- Reliable high‑speed internet connection and a quiet, ergonomically suitable workspace.
- Strong self‑management skills, including the ability to prioritize tasks and meet deadlines without direct supervision.
- Commitment to data confidentiality and adherence to security best practices.
